Output 59bee5a50e0b6dd19a603641137813ba07362280c3595ac18c562781a45e6f50:3

value
23594602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427ae3d4cb40dab188995e7a6c7e6e3d74993053 OP_EQUAL
address
MDxg3dp6MbRYCFniNnDqQz8qwkG5QpFUSU
transaction
59bee5a50e0b6dd19a603641137813ba07362280c3595ac18c562781a45e6f50
spent
true